I just want to make sure you understand that you will not save any energy with 
such a system. Placing any kind of turbine in the water path will result with 
to things: Or the pump will force to keep the same flow in order to compensate 
for the restriction caused by the turbine. This will increase the power 
consumption of the pump. The other possibility is that the flow will decrease. 
This means less water circulation in your pool.
 
With that said I have a suggestion for you: To keep the same water circulation 
in your pool simply add a heater directly connected to the grid. With some 
skills it can easily be done yourself . Most of the part can be found at 
Mcmaster. This will cost some electricity but certainly not more than your 
turbine project. If your plan is to save electricity cost then place a timer on 
your pump. Energy saved can be use to heat your pool with the heater mentionned 
above.
